An 80.0-g puck moving at 1.20 m/s on an air table collides with a stationary 100-g puck. After the collision, the 80.0-g puck moves in a direction that makes an angle of 45.0° with the original direction of motion and the 100-g puck moves at an angle of 12.0° in the opposite direction. What is the speed of the 80.0-g puck after the collision?
A) 0.809 m/s
B) 0.297 m/s
C) 0.533 m/s
D) 0.0953 m/s
E) 1.23 m/s
